Abstract

We consider the following system of Volterra integral equations: {Mathematical expression} and some of its particular cases that arise from physical problems. Criteria are offered for the existence of one and more constant-sign solutions u = (u1, u2, ..., un) of the system in (C [0, T])n. We say u is of constant sign if for each 1 ≤ i ≤ n, θi ui (t) ≥ 0 for all t ∈ [0, T], where θi ∈ {1, - 1} is fixed. Examples are also included to illustrate the results obtained.
